What Is Discord Anyway?

If you've never heard of Discord before, don't worry - it's super simple! Discord is like a big online clubhouse where people with similar interests can talk to each other. Think of it like a playground, but instead of swings and slides, there are different rooms where people chat about different topics.

For Plants vs Brainrots, there's an official Discord server (that's what they call a community on Discord). In this server, you can chat with other players, ask questions, share your victories, and even play with new friends! The best part? You can access Discord on your computer, phone, or tablet, so you can join the conversation from anywhere.

Your parents might need to help you set up Discord since it requires an email address to sign up. Once you're in though, it's easy to use. You just type messages like texting, and everyone in that room can see and respond to you!

Staying Safe and Being Nice

Now, as awesome as the Discord community is, there are some important rules to follow. These rules keep everyone safe and make sure the community stays friendly.

First, always be respectful to everyone. If someone makes a mistake or asks a "dumb" question, be patient and kind. Remember, you were new once too! The community values friendness above everything else. Mean people get warnings, and if they continue being mean, they get removed from the server.

Second, never share personal information like your real name, address, school, phone number, or passwords. Even though most Discord members are nice, you never know who's reading messages. Keep your personal life private! It's okay to be friends online without sharing personal details.

Third, if you want to trade items with someone, use the official trading system and be careful. Some people try to scam others by promising things they don't deliver. If a deal seems too good to be true, it probably is! Ask a moderator for help if you're unsure about a trade.

Fourth, follow your parents' rules about online gaming. If they want to check the Discord, that's okay! Show them how nice and well-moderated the community is. If they have concerns, the moderators are happy to talk to parents. Everyone understands that safety comes first.

Finally, if anyone makes you uncomfortable or acts inappropriately, tell a moderator immediately. The moderators are adults who volunteer their time to keep the server safe. They take safety seriously and will handle any problems quickly and quietly.
